I believe a majority of street photographers find street images with individuals in them to be extra intriguing. With that being stated, metropolitan landscapes have their location also.


Downtown town hall are where you'll run into the biggest number of people to consist of in your pictures. It's not ensured by any type of means that you'll take your ideal road pictures in these areas, yet it's a good place to begin as a result of the number of individuals you'll go across paths with and individuals in these locations generally pay you and your cam less attention due to the fact that it's not as evident as to what you're photographing.


By shooting in more booming areas when you're simply starting, you get a much less complicated chance to photo scenes with people in them which can decrease some anxieties that feature doing street digital photography and provide you a bit of self-confidence progressing. A lot of the fantastic street digital photographers shoot with wide angle lenses, 35mm possibly being one of the most typical. The reason being is it just functions well.


However I assume a more relevant reason for making use of a 35 or 28mm lens in road photography is because it reveals the intimacy of the street. Road photography demonstrates how people browse public and shared areas, oftentimes in close quarters. By utilizing a wide angle lens for road photography, you obtain to show people what it was like when you existed




It might trigger you stress and anxiety or concern, however it's something you can overcome with time and technique. This isn't to claim you can not utilize a longer lens for street photography. I've in fact seen some road photography with longer lenses done extremely well. But also for the many part, you lose that feeling of affection with a telephoto lens.
